Stearic acid methyl ester is an esterified version of the free acid which is less water soluble but more amenable for the formulation of stearate-containing diets and dietary supplements. Stearic acid (Item No. 10011298) is a long-chain saturated fatty acid that can be derived from either animal fats or vegetable oils. Compared to other long-chain saturated fatty acids that are hypercholesterolemic, experimental diets high in stearic acid (9.3-11.8% of energy) do not raise plasma total cholesterol or LDL cholesterol concentrations but may slightly reduce HDL cholesterol concentrations.1,2
